How to Choose Sand Making Equipment for Efficient Quarry Sand Processing?

1. Assess Your Production Needs

Before investing in sand making equipment, clearly define your production requirements. Consider aspects such as:

  • Output Volume: Determine how much sand you need to produce daily or weekly.
  • Sand Quality: Establish specifications for grain size, impurities, and uniformity.
  • Material Type: Identify the types of raw materials you will be processing, such as granite, limestone, or gravel.

2. Understand the Types of Sand Making Equipment

Familiarizing yourself with the different types of sand making equipment can help streamline your decision-making process. Some of the most common include:

  • Vertical Shaft Impactors (VSIs): Ideal for producing high-quality sand with consistent grain size.
  • Hammer Mills: Suitable for creating finer sand from larger rocks but may produce more dust.
  • Cone Crushers: Useful for shaping materials and ensuring a more uniform particle size.

3. Evaluate Energy Efficiency

Energy costs can significantly affect your operational expenses. Therefore, prioritize equipment that offers:

  • Low Power Consumption: Choose machines with efficient motors and energy-saving features.
  • Hybrid Technologies: Explore options that combine different sand-making technologies for better energy use.
  • Durability: Invest in reliable equipment that reduces the need for frequent repairs, thereby lowering energy waste.

4. Focus on Automation Features

Modern sand-making equipment often comes with advanced automation features. When evaluating options, look for:

  • Remote Monitoring: Systems that allow you to track equipment performance and production metrics from afar.
  • Automated Adjustments: Machines that can automatically adjust settings for optimal performance based on material characteristics.
  • Integration with Control Systems: Compatibility with existing control systems for seamless operation.

5. Consider Maintenance and Support

Choosing the right equipment extends beyond initial purchase. Ensure to consider:

  • Availability of Spare Parts: Confirm that essential components are readily available to minimize downtime.
  • Technical Support: Investigate the manufacturer's reputation for after-sales service.
  • Ease of Maintenance: Look for equipment that is designed for straightforward maintenance procedures.

6. Budgeting and Financial Assessment

Last but not least, carefully analyze your budget. Make sure to assess:

  • Initial Purchase Costs: Evaluate the upfront investment required for different models.
  • Operating Costs: Estimate long-term operational expenses including power, maintenance, and labor.
  • Return on Investment (ROI): Calculate potential ROI based on expected production output and market demand.
